Understanding the Core Mechanics of Chicken Road
At its heart, a chicken road game is a multiplier-based crash game. A virtual chicken begins a journey along a series of lines, and with each step the chicken takes, a multiplier increases. Players place bets before the round begins and have the opportunity to “cash out” at any point, securing their winnings based on the current multiplier. However, if the chicken “crashes” – meaning it encounters an obstacle – all outstanding bets are lost. The core appeal lies in the risk/reward dynamic: the longer you wait, the higher the potential payout, but the greater the risk of losing your entire stake. The Role of Random Number Generators (RNGs)
The fairness and integrity of chicken road games, like all online casino games, rely heavily on Random Number Generators (RNGs). These algorithms produce unpredictable sequences of numbers that determine the outcome of each round. Reputable online casinos employ certified RNGs that are regularly audited by independent testing agencies to ensure fairness and randomness. This provides players with confidence that the games are not manipulated and that every player has an equal chance of winning. Transparency regarding the RNG is a hallmark of trustworthy online casinos.

Understanding the Return to Player (RTP)
The Return to Player (RTP) percentage represents the theoretical amount of money that a game will return to players over a long period of time. For chicken road games, the typical RTP is around 98%, which is relatively high compared to many other casino games. This means that, on average, players can expect to receive back 98% of their total wagers over a substantial number of rounds. However, it’s important to note that RTP is a theoretical calculation and does not guarantee individual winnings.
